110. Habitats, Invasive Species, and Possibly Antagonistic Bear Interactions w/ Ashley Bray

Explore the evolutionary chess game between giraffes and acacia trees, revealing how these magnificent creatures and resilient plants have developed unique adaptations over millennia. From the buff-tailed sickleback hummingbird's specialized relationship with Heliconia flowers to the seasonal dietary shifts of white-tailed deer, we spotlight the complex and often delicate balance that underpins our natural world. The importance of respecting and preserving these natural processes is underscored, highlighting the need for minimal human interference to ensure the survival and health of wildlife.
As we navigate conservation challenges, Ashley provides insights into the role of fire in ecosystem health, the plight of monarch butterflies, and the increasing presence of black bears in urban areas. Learn about the critical role science communication and podcasting play in debunking myths and spreading awareness about wildlife. From personal stories of animal encounters to the importance of maintaining natural habitats, this episode promises a rich tapestry of knowledge and inspiration for anyone passionate about the environment. Join us for this enlightening discussion, packed with real-world experiences and expert insights that will deepen your appreciation for the interconnectedness of our natural world.
